Bicentennial Quilt Nahant Historical Society After the blocks were set together, the strips and borders were quilted in a star pattern. there are fifty large, five pointed stars representing the fifty states. Members of the homemakers council created this 64 square bicentennial quilt for the 1976 bicentennial to celebrate louisiana’s unique culture. individual square patches were designed and executed by members of the council to represent the 64 parishes of louisiana. International quilt museum, university of nebraska lincoln the people's bicentennial quilt was made by 45 female quiltmakers in california to show a more complicated version of america's history. The "official" winner of the national bicentennial quilt contest is a piece of history in itself. it’s titled "the great american quilt" and it features 52 blocks—one for each state plus d.c. and a central commemorative block. We’re coming up on july 4th, so let’s celebrate with the story of the hopewell u. s. bicentennial quilt from 1976. the quilt is 9 by 8 feet, with 42 squares in a 7 x 6 grid that illustrate local themes. Despite their collective history of disappointments, and arguably the hollow promise of the bicentennial, the makers of the afro american heritage bicentennial commemorative quilt decided to fight racism by stressing citizenship rather than bitterness.
